analytics - Power BI Desktop 导入数据限制
问题描述
当我使用 Power BI 导入(连接到 SQL Server 并选择导入)将数据导入 Power BI Desktop 时,是否存在数据量限制?
我知道 DirectQuery 没有数据量限制。进口呢?是1GB吗?
解决方案
导入数据方法的大小限制为每个模型 1GB。因此,在不使用 Power BI Premium 的情况下,这种方法的可扩展性并不高。
在阅读上述关于导入数据的解释后,您可能会得到的第一个假设是:如果您有一个 100GB 的数据库,那么如果您将其导入 Power BI,您将在 Power BI 中获得 100GB 的文件大小。这不是真的。Power BI 利用 xVelocity 的压缩引擎并使用 Column-store in-memory 技术。列存储内存技术压缩数据并以压缩格式存储。有时你可能有一个 1GB 的 Excel 文件,当你将它导入 Power BI 时,你的 Power BI 文件最终只有 10MB。这主要是因为 Power BI 的压缩引擎。然而,压缩率并不总是这样。这取决于很多事情;列中唯一值的数量,有时是数据类型和许多其他情况。稍后我会写一篇文章详细解释压缩引擎。
这部分的简短阅读是:Power BI 将存储压缩数据。Power BI 中的数据大小将远小于其在数据源中的大小。
http://radacad.com/directquery-live-connection-or-import-data-tough-decision
推荐阅读
- c++ - stackalloc 是如何工作的?
- javascript - 如何动态更改RequiredField?
- r - 如何更改 flexdashboard 值框中的 fa-icon 大小?
- hive - 从 HIve 中的数组中获取下一个结构项
- unix - 如何使用 Awk 使用双引号下的列值过滤行
- java - 使用 Spring-boot Application 中的 Spring Security 使用 Active Directory(使用 AD 域)对用户进行身份验证时出现问题
- android - 在 Instagram 中使用分享意图。如何知道用户实际分享或取消了分享活动?
- javascript - Filereader 在读取为 readAsArrayBuffer 时使用正确的编码读取文件
- java - Jackson:如何获取在序列化或反序列化期间解析的完整 JSON 字符串
- python - 在不使用库的情况下用 python 编写图像